Lady Vikes Outlast Chukars

The Viking Volleyball team took the win on Saturday afternoon against the visiting Chukars of Treasure Valley CC in five sets: 23-25, 25-17, 14-25, 25-21, 15-9.  The win comes after the Vikings travelled to Columbia Basin College on Friday against the second ranked Hawks and suffered a tough loss against the home team.  Head Coach Michael De Hoog stated "This was a big win for us.  We've played against six of the top ten ranked teams in the pre-season.  You don't always get a good gauge of what you are capable of with a young team facing those kind of teams.  We've been close, so it's nice to see the effort pay off in the win column." 

Jordyn Adams had a monster game with 10 kills, 4 assists, 3 aces and a season high 23 digs. Grace Fedie also had a stellar showing collecting 9 kills and 20 digs while Laura Forsgren served as the main facilitator with 24 assists, 24 digs and adding 4 kills to lead the Lady Vikes to victory. A well rounded team effort with BBCC accumulating 36 kills and 111 digs.
